From 321295c1d75e112ca49df5bab55584041ef47250 Mon Sep 17 00:00:00 2001 From: saravanank Date: Sat, 4 May 2019 21:34:59 -0700 Subject: [PATCH] pimd: Implementation of show ip pim bsrp-info. This command displays the group to rp mappings received from BSR. Sw3# show ip pim bsrp-info BSR Address 30.0.0.100 Group Address 225.1.1.1/32 -------------------------- Rp Address priority Holdtime Hash (ACTIVE) 20.0.0.2 0 150 1533588312 2.2.2.2 0 150 1524600152 9.9.9.10 0 150 1489835248 7.7.2.7 0 150 1230207135 7.2.2.7 0 150 1093826719 7.7.9.7 0 150 897086367 7.8.9.10 0 150 811603184 7.5.2.7 0 150 746158239 9.10.9.10 0 150 658117872 (PENDING) Pending RP count :0 Partial List is empty. Group Address 226.1.1.1/32 -------------------------- Rp Address priority Holdtime Hash (ACTIVE) 9.9.9.9 0 150 326773161 (PENDING) Pending RP count :0 Partial List is empty.
